Couple of pics/vids for you guys. Got 2 new triggers this past weekend. A larger Lei (aka Boomerang) Trigger from an LFS out in Palm Bay, and a Sargassum from member tangers here on RC.

The Lei is currently in my 55gal QT, doing great, took to hand feeding on the second day. Probably is a bit over 6" in length. Could be a bit fatter (a 6" trig should be as thick as a novel IMO), but that's what QT is for.

The Sargassum is about 4". Since he was removed from tangers tank, with all of the fish in great health, I didn't feel the need to QT this one. A bit shy like all Xan. triggers on introduction.
